单片机原理知识点总结
“单片机原理知识点总结”相关的资料有哪些?“单片机原理知识点总结”相关的范文有哪些?怎么写?下面是小编为您精心整理的“单片机原理知识点总结”相关范文大全或资料大全,欢迎大家分享。
单片机原理及应用考试复习知识点
单片机原理及应用考试复习知识点
第1章 计算机基础知识
考试知识点:
1、各种进制之间的转换
(1)各种进制转换为十进制数
方法:各位按权展开相加即可。 (2)十进制数转换为各种进制
方法:整数部分采用“除基取余法”,小数部分采用“乘基取整法”。 (3)二进制数与十六进制数之间的相互转换
方法:每四位二进制转换为一位十六进制数。 2、带符号数的三种表示方法
(1)原码:机器数的原始表示,最高位为符号位(0‘+’1‘-’),其余各位为数值位。 (2)反码:正数的反码与原码相同。负数的反码把原码的最高位不变,其余各位求反。 (3)补码:正数的补码与原码相同。负数的补码为反码加1。
原码、反码的表示范围:-127~+127,补码的表示范围:-128~+127。 3、计算机中使用的编码
(1)BCD码:每4位二进制数对应1位十进制数。
(2)ASCII码:7位二进制数表示字符。0~9的ASCII码30H~39H,A的ASCII码41H,a的ASCII码61H。 考试复习题:
1、求十进制数-102的补码(以2位16进制数表示),该补码为 。 2、123= B= H。
3、只有在________码表示
单片机复习知识点2017
单片机复习知识点
一、理论知识:
1. 二进制与十进制的转换(要求会计算) 二进制转十进制:加权求和。 十进制转二进制:
整数部分:除二取余,逆序排列,即最初得到的余数是二进制整数的最低位,最后得到的余数是二进制整数的最高位,如下所示:
小数部分:乘二取整,顺序排列,即最初得到的整数是二进制小数的最高位,如下所示:
2. 什么是单片机?
将微处理器(CPU)、存储器(ROM 和RAM)及各种输入输出接口(I/O)集成在一个芯片上,就称之为单片微型处理器,简称单片机。存储器按功能划分可分为程序存储器和数据存储器。
3. 单片机最小系统的组成:
单片机最小系统由工作电源、时钟(或晶振)电路和复位电路三部分组成,它为单片机的工作提供最基本的硬件条件。
4. 单片机的复位条件是什么,复位后的I/O 口状态是什么?
单片机的复位条件是持续两个机器周期以上的高电平,复位后的I/O 口为FFH。 5. 单片机的时序:
晶振电路为单片机的工作提供了基本的时序。
时钟周期:也称振荡周期,定义为时钟频率的倒数,也就是外接晶振频率的倒数,是单片机
1
中最基本、最小的时间单位。
机器周期:单片机的基本操作周期,在一个操作周期内,单片机完成一项基本操作,它由12 个时钟
单片机 考试 知识点 总结 太原理工大学 葬仪落整理
一、填空题:
1、当使用8051单片机时,需要扩展外部程序存储器,此时EA应接低电平。
2、8051上电复位后,从地址0000H开始执行程序,外部中断1的中断入口地址为0013H. 3、8051最多有64KB的程序存储器和64KB的数据存储器。
4、P0口通常用作分时复用为地址总线(低8位)及数据总线或外接上拉电阻用作普通I/O口。
5、P2口的功能为用作地址总线和作为普通I/O口使用。
6、若由程序设定RS1、RS0=01,则工作寄存器R0的直接地址为08H。 7、若由程序设定RS1、RS0=00,则工作寄存器R0的直接地址为00H。
8、若累加器A中的数据为01110010B,则PSW中的P=0(偶数个1为0,奇数为1)
9、8051单片机共有5个中断源,分别是INT0外部中断0、INT1外部中断1、T0定时器/计数器中断0中断、T1定时器计数器1中断、串行口中断。 10、ADC0809是8通路8位逐次逼近式模/数转换器。
11、计算机中按功能把总线分为数据总线、地址总线和控制总线。
12、MOV A,#0F5H中,#0F5H的寻址方式称之为立即寻址。MOV类指令称之为一般传输指令。
13、8051的一个机器周期等于12个晶体震荡周期;通
单片机 考试 知识点 总结 太原理工大学 葬仪落整理
一、填空题:
1、当使用8051单片机时,需要扩展外部程序存储器,此时EA应接低电平。
2、8051上电复位后,从地址0000H开始执行程序,外部中断1的中断入口地址为0013H. 3、8051最多有64KB的程序存储器和64KB的数据存储器。
4、P0口通常用作分时复用为地址总线(低8位)及数据总线或外接上拉电阻用作普通I/O口。
5、P2口的功能为用作地址总线和作为普通I/O口使用。
6、若由程序设定RS1、RS0=01,则工作寄存器R0的直接地址为08H。 7、若由程序设定RS1、RS0=00,则工作寄存器R0的直接地址为00H。
8、若累加器A中的数据为01110010B,则PSW中的P=0(偶数个1为0,奇数为1)
9、8051单片机共有5个中断源,分别是INT0外部中断0、INT1外部中断1、T0定时器/计数器中断0中断、T1定时器计数器1中断、串行口中断。 10、ADC0809是8通路8位逐次逼近式模/数转换器。
11、计算机中按功能把总线分为数据总线、地址总线和控制总线。
12、MOV A,#0F5H中,#0F5H的寻址方式称之为立即寻址。MOV类指令称之为一般传输指令。
13、8051的一个机器周期等于12个晶体震荡周期;通
西北农林科技大学单片机知识点
汇编指令由操作码或伪操作码、目的操作数和源操作数构成 DW(Define Word) 定义数据字命令
功能:用于从指定地址开始,在程序存储器单元中定义16位的数据字。 格式: [标号:] DW 16位数表 存放规则:高8位在前(低地址),低8位在后(高地址)。 DS(Define Storage) 定义存储区命令
功能:用于从指定地址开始,保留指定数目的字节单元为存储区,供程序运行使用。汇编时对这些单元不赋值。
格式: [标号:] DS 16位数表
用EQU可以把一个汇编符号赋给字符名称,如上例中的R1,而DATA只能把数据赋给字符名。 寻 址 方 式 立即数寻址 直接寻址 寄存器寻址 寻 址 空 间 ROM(汇编后数据直接存放在ROM中) 片内低128字节和SFR 通用寄存器R0~R7 某些SFR,如A、B(乘除指令中)、DPTR 片内RAM低128B[@Ri,SP(仅PUSH和POP)] 片外RAM(@Ri,@DPTR) ROM(@A + PC,@A + DPTR) ROM 256B范围 片内RAM 20H~2FH单
单片机原理及精华总结
2.1微机原理概述
迄今为止,所有计算机的组成结构都是冯·诺伊曼型的,即:它是执行存储器中程序而工作的。计算机执行程序是自动按序进行的,毋需人工干预,程序和数据由输入设备输入存储器,执行程序所获得的运算结果由输出设备输出。因此,计算机通常有运算控制部件、存储器部件、输入设备和输出设备四部分组成,如图2-1所示。
图2-1 计算机组成框图
输入设备能自动把人们编好的解题程序和原始数据转换成计算机能识别的二进制数码,送到存储器存放起来。常用的输入设备有键盘、纸带输入机和卡片读入机,等等。此外,当计算机从磁盘上读入程序和数据时,磁盘驱动器也是作为输入设备而工作的。因此,输入设备是计算机输入解题程序和原始数据不可缺少的部件。
运算控制器有运算器和控制器两部分电子线路组成,是计算机赖以工作的核心部件。运算器主要包括加法器、移位、判断和寄存器电路等等,用于进行算术运算和逻辑操作;控制器由指令寄存器、指令译码器和控制电路等组成,是整个计算机的中枢,它根据指令码指挥着运算器、存储器、输入设备和输出设备自动协调地工作(如图中箭头所示)。因此,运算器和控制器唇齿相依,融为一体。过去,运算器和控制器采用电子管、晶体管和集成电路芯片组成,体积十分庞大。现在,运算
单片机PPT知识点整理
PPT知识点整理: 第一章 单片机概述
1、一个完整的计算机系统包括两大部分,即硬件系统和软件系统。其基本组成如下图所示:
2、计算机的制造技术都是基于科学家冯·诺依曼1946年提出的“程序存储”概念。这样的计算机称为冯·诺依曼体系结构计算机。
3、冯·诺依曼体系结构的思想可以概括为以下几点:
(1)由运算器、存储器、控制器、输入设备和输出设备等五大基本部分组成计算机系统,并规定了这五部分的基本功能。(2)计算机内部采用二进制来表示数据和指令。(3)采用存储程序即把编好的程序和原始数据预先存入计算机主存中,使计算机工作时能连续、自动、高速地从存储器中取出一条条指令并执行,从而自动完成预定的任务。
4、典型的冯.诺依曼计算机结构框图
5、哈佛结构单片机:程序存储器和数据存储器是分开的,并且有各自的寻址机构和寻址方式。
6、计算机的基本工作原理为存储程序和执行指令。 7、计算机的主要性能指标:(1)字长(2)运算速度(3)时钟频率(主频)(4)内存容量 8、将组成微型计算机的各功能部件: 中央处理器 存储器 输入设备 输出设备
等制作在一块集成电路芯片中从而构成完整的微型计算机-故称作单晶片微型计算机
单片机知识点整理(高级) - 图文
单片机知识点整理
一、 书本课后练习
第1章P35, 3、4、5、7、8、9
1、MCU是英文Micro Controller Unit的缩写,中文含义是 微控制器。P1 2、MCU选型时主要应该注意哪三个方面的因素?各自含义是什么?P11 适用性:主要考虑MCU的片内资源能否满足实际需要 可开发性:所选择的的MCU是否有足够的开发手段
可购买性:MCU是否容易购买;MCU是否有足够的供应量;MCU是否仍然在生产之中;MCU是否在改进之中 3、Freescale S08系列MCU的HCS08核由哪些部分组成?CPU寄存器有哪几个、位数是多少、各有什么作用?P27-P31
HCS08核由下面四部分组成:HCS08CPU,背景调试器,支持高达32个中断/复位源的中断/复位机制,片级地址解码器。
AW60CPU寄存器包括一个8位的累加器A、一个16位的变址寄存器H:X、一个16位的堆栈指示器SP、一个16位的程序计数器PC和一个8位的条件码寄存器CCR。
累加器A(Accumulator):8位通用寄存器,用来存放操作数和运算结果
变址寄存器HX(Index Pointer) :16位寄存器,H是高8位,X是低8位,可单独使用
堆栈指针SP(S
单片机原理作业(CXH)
MCS-51单片机作业
第一部分 基础
练习一
1.1234?X2=2512? 问这是几进制的运算?
在9进制系统中,469+??=1009
2.将下列二进制数转换为十进制数和十六进制数:
10111101B 110111101B
111011010.101B 11110111101110.111011111B 3.将下列十进制数转换为二进制数,对于小数,可以仅取4位 130 123.47 99 0.6 256 11.11 4.计算下列二进制算式:
10100110B-101B 11011110B+1101B 1110B×1011B 10111010B÷110B
5.将下列算式转换成十六进制和二进制数,对于小数,可以仅取二位十六进制数 12767 60000 123.143 65535 32767
单片机原理实验5
单片机原理实验讲义
郭海燕 周小方编
漳州师范学院物理与电子信息工程系
2010年11月
单片机原理实验
前 言
随着微电子技术的发展,当前各种电子设备中几乎都能见到微控制器的身影,《单片机原理》课程是电子信息科学与技术、电子信息工程、电气工程及其自动化等本科专业学生的重要专业课,是这些专业学生首次学习与微控制器有关的课程,学好本课程内容,掌握单片机应用系统程序设计方法,养成良好的设计规范,对学生进一步学习其它功能更强、复杂性更高的微控制器(或微处理器)有重要意义。
课程主要讲述51系列单片机的内部结构、指令系统和编程设计方法,是一门实践性很强的课程。本实验讲义共安排六个实验,分别为:
实验一、单片机集成开发环境入门;
实验二、I/O口输入输出实验――循环灯程序设计;
实验三、I/O口输入输出实验――LED数码管动态显示与按键去抖程序设计; 实验四、定时器应用实验――LED数码动态显示与矩阵键盘赋值程序设计; 实验五、计数器应用实验――基于热敏电阻和555电路的简易温度报警系统设计; 实验六、中断实验――简易温度控制器设计。
其中实验一是入门实验,为基础性实验,另五个实验为设计性、综合性实验。
围绕“简易温度控制器”这个实际应用系统的设计的